Comprehending Human-Wildlife Disputes



Human-wildlife conflicts usually arise when the natural environments of animals intersect with human activities, leading to competitors for sources and space. As urbanization and agricultural expansion remain to encroach upon wildlife territories, animals such as coyotes, raccoons, and deer find themselves in closer distance to human populations. This closeness can lead to detrimental impacts on both wild animals and humans, as pets might create damages to crops, facilities, and personal residential or commercial property while human beings may accidentally damage wild animals with environment devastation and various other anthropogenic pressures.


The intricacy of these conflicts comes from a variety of factors. Modifications in land use, climate adjustment, and the fragmentation of ecological communities often force wildlife to adjust to brand-new atmospheres, occasionally leading them right into business or domestic locations. Additionally, the availability of human-generated food resources, such as trash and pet dog food, can bring in wildlife to human negotiations, worsening communications and potential conflicts.


Attending to human-wildlife conflicts needs a nuanced understanding of pet habits, eco-friendly dynamics, and socio-economic factors to consider. By researching these policymakers, guardians and communications can create strategies that intend to reduce problems while preserving biodiversity and preserving environmental balance. The goal is to promote conjunction and minimize unfavorable effects on both human areas and wildlife populations.


Significance of Non-Lethal Techniques



Non-lethal approaches of wildlife elimination personify this principles by supplying solutions that protect against injury to wild animals while attending to human concerns. By utilizing such techniques, we can handle wildlife interactions without resorting to dangerous steps, thus preserving animal populaces and decreasing moral problems associated with killing.


These approaches frequently verify extra effective in the long term, as eliminating private animals can develop a gap that is rapidly filled up by various other participants of the types or different types completely. This can lead to a cycle of recurring elimination initiatives, whereas non-lethal deterrents attend to the origin creates of wild animals existence.




Additionally, non-lethal strategies foster conjunction by informing the general public regarding wildlife habits and encouraging harmonious living methods. This awareness can bring about a lot more sustainable human-wildlife communications, eventually safeguarding both neighborhood interests and animal well-being.

Strategies for Efficient Removal



Carrying out effective techniques for humane wild animals elimination requires a thorough understanding of pet behavior and habitat demands. This knowledge serves as the foundation for developing strategies that make sure the honest and secure relocation of wild animals.


One more crucial method is utilizing helpful hints exemption techniques, which concentrate on securing entry points to prevent animals from going back to frameworks. This technique not just deals with the instant problem but also works as a long-lasting solution, lowering future problems between humans and wild animals. The use of safe deterrents and repellents can urge pets to leave locations voluntarily, complementing other removal initiatives.




Capture and moving ought to constantly be a last option, utilized only when pets position a direct hazard or are not able to leave by themselves. In such cases, utilizing gentle catches and making sure the launch of animals in appropriate environments are important to safeguarding their well-being. Partnership with wildlife professionals and adherence to legal laws additionally enhance the effectiveness of these methods.
